Lavrov said: Ukraine has banned these...

Ukraine has blocked 86 Russian TV channels in its territory.

Axar.az reports that Russian Foreign Minister Sergei Lavrov said this.

He also said that 181 Russian websites, movies and books in Russian were banned in Ukraine.

Ukraine has previously banned the distribution of Russian-language media in the country on charges of posing a threat to national security. The other reason was the occupation of Crimea by Russia and the Donbas conflict.
